Switch fabric to provide a method for changing the packages from input ports to output ports. The switching matrix must arbitrate traffic when more than one packet arrives at the same time if the two are destined to the same output port. Buffer switch fabrics offer enough to handle situations in which the packet input rate is greater than the ¯ s switch fabric capacity performance.

The two possible locations for temporary storage at the entrance of the switching matrix (input queue) or internally to the structure switch (shared memory). Control switch fabric quality of service (QoS).

The switching matrix is responsible for receiving data from a card line and onto the correct target.
